Job Description

Crossover is seeking a Curriculum Developer for 2 Hour Learning, offering a salary of $100,000/year. This remote role focuses on innovating social studies education by using AI technology to create engaging, interactive learning experiences in history and geography. Candidates should have a relevant degree, teaching experience, and strong analytical skills. The position emphasizes collaboration and creativity in developing cutting-edge educational resources.

What you will be doing
• Harnessing AI to design interactive simulations that make historical events and geographical phenomena tangible and memorable for students.
• Analyzing learning data to uncover patterns that will inform adaptive pathways, ensuring every student’s unique journey is engaging and effective.
• Developing cutting-edge digital resources that bring historical figures and global landscapes to life, from virtual journeys through time to immersive cultural explorations.
• Collaborating with a multidisciplinary team of educators and technologists to craft innovative approaches that redefine how social studies is taught and experienced.
• Translating complex historical and geographic concepts into engaging, digestible content enhanced with AI-driven personalization.

What you will NOT be doing
• Managing traditional curricula or bogging down in administrative duties—this role is about innovation and real-world impact.
• Operating in a vacuum—you’ll work alongside a team of passionate experts committed to pushing boundaries.
• Sticking to textbook methods—your work will revolutionize how students connect with history and geography.

Key Responsibilities

Drive measurable improvement in students' mastery of social studies concepts, doubling the speed at which they internalize key historical and geographic knowledge through innovative, AI-driven methodologies.

Candidate Requirements
• Bachelor’s degree or higher in History, Geography, or a related field.
• 3+ years of experience teaching or developing social studies curricula, with demonstrable results in improving student outcomes.
• Strong analytical skills, with the ability to interpret data and derive actionable insights.
• Experience with AI applications in education, such as content creation, adaptive learning, or data analysis.
• Outstanding communication skills to translate complex social studies topics into engaging narratives.
